JavaScript Ajax Json實現上下級下拉框聯動效果執行個體代碼_javascript技巧

最近嘗試做出一個部門和人員的下拉框聯動功能,部門和人員的對應關係是1:N複製代碼 代碼如下:<div class="forntName">部門</div> <div class="inpBox"> <select  name="department" id="department"  onchange="change();" style="width:200px;" > <option

Javascript Ajax非同步讀取RSS文檔具體實現_javascript技巧

RSS 是一種基於 XML的檔案標準,通過符合 RSS 規範的 XML檔案可以簡單實現網站之間的內容共用。Ajax 是Asynchronous JavaScript and XML的縮寫。通過 Ajax 技術可以經由超文字傳輸通訊協定 (HTTP)(Http) 向一個伺服器發出請求並且在等待該響應時繼續處理另外的資料。通過 Ajax 技術可以很容易實現讀取遠程 XML檔案,因此,可以使用 Ajax技術實現遠端存取依據 RSS 標準產生的摘要資訊,甚至我們可以自己寫一個 RSS

禁止ajax緩衝擷取程式最新資料的方法_javascript技巧

今天做項目,幾乎所有的提交都是通過ajax來提交,我測試的時候發現,每次提交後得到的資料都是一樣的,調試可以排除後台代碼的問題,所以問題肯定是出在前台。每次清除緩衝後,就會得到一個新的資料,所以歸根到底就是瀏覽器緩衝問題。糾結了很久,終於解決了,在這裡總結一下。我們都知道ajax能提高頁面載入的速度主要的原因是通過ajax減少了重複資料的載入,也就是說在載入資料的同時將資料緩衝到記憶體中,一旦資料被載入其中,只要我們沒有重新整理頁面,這些資料就會一直被緩衝在記憶體中,當我們提交

js每隔5分鐘執行一次ajax請求的實現方法_javascript技巧

一個頁面好像只能有一個 window.onload=function(){},所以要有多個事件,這樣寫就好了 複製代碼 代碼如下: window.onload=function(){ //假設這裡每個五分鐘執行一次test函數 publicBusi(); personBusi(); } function publicBusi(){ setTimeout(personBusi,1000*60*7);//這裡的1000表示1秒有1000毫秒,1分鐘有60秒,7表示總共7分鐘

js動態建立上傳表單通過iframe類比Ajax實現無重新整理_javascript技巧

複製代碼 代碼如下: <script> window.onload=function(){ upfile('file.php'); } /* ** url 路徑 **/ function upfile(url){ //建立iframe var iframe = document.createElement("iframe"); document.body.appendChild(iframe); iframe.id = 'iframeName'; iframe.name =

利用了jquery的ajax實現二級聯互動菜單_javascript技巧

菜單資源儲存在資料庫中。利用了jquery的ajax實現。用到的包有:json-lib-2.2.3-jdk15.jar ezmorph-1.0.6.jar json.js jquery.js jsp頁面的代碼: 複製代碼 代碼如下: <%@ page contentType="text/html; charset=gbk"%> <%@ taglib prefix="s" uri="/struts-tags"%> <script

js jquery ajax的幾種用法總結(及優缺點介紹)_javascript技巧

這篇文章,是我不知道什麼是ajax到熟練運用ajax的一個曆程。一,最原始的方式來運用ajax複製代碼 代碼如下:<SCRIPT language=javascript>var xmlHttp;function createXMLHttpRequest() {if (window.ActiveXObject) {xmlHttp = new ActiveXObject("Microsoft.XMLHTTP");}else if (window.XMLHttpRequest)

Ajax同步與非同步傳輸的範例程式碼_javascript技巧

複製代碼 代碼如下://同步傳輸模式   function RequestByGet(nProducttemp,nCountrytemp)   {       var xmlhttp       if (window.XMLHttpRequest)        

javascript類比實現ajax載入框執行個體_javascript技巧

本文執行個體講述了javascript類比實現ajax載入框的方法,分享給大家供大家參考。具體方法如下:複製代碼 代碼如下:function loading(p_value,str){if (p_value){ if (!document.getElementById("load_area")){var para1 = document.createElement("span");var

Ajax局部更新導致JS事件重複觸發問題的解決方案_javascript技巧

如果在頁面中包含一個ajax更新的列表,那麼需要小心非動態更新部分的事件處理。以帶有公用工具列的列表介面為例:| Menu1 | Menu2----------------------------------------------------------------------------ID TITLE DESCRIPTION OPERATION1 test1 hey test X - ...2 test2 why not X - ...---------------------------

IE下Ajax緩衝問題的快速解決方案(get方式)_javascript技巧

折騰了半天,程式中使用jquery的load方法進行請求,很奇怪為啥第二次無法發送請求。百度了一把,誰知load是用get方式進行請求的,因此IE瀏覽器對其進行緩衝了。網上搜了很多解決方案,一大把,下面是我認為比較全面的解決方案。主要分為用戶端解決和服務端解決。1.用戶端解決方案IE存取原則:Internet選項--瀏覽歷程記錄--設定-- Internet 臨時檔案的選項改為每次訪問網頁時也可以 1: 在AJAX請求的頁面後加個隨機函數,我們可以使用隨機時間函數

原生Javascript封裝的一個AJAX函數分享_javascript技巧

最近的工作中涉及到大量的ajax操作,本來該後台做的事也要我來做了.而現在使用的ajax函數是一個後台人員封裝的—-但他又是基於jquery的ajax,所以離開了jquery這個函數就毫無作用了.而且我覺得,jquery的ajax方法是很完善的了,可以直接用,如果都有jquery了,那麼他的ajax就不用白不用了.我缺少的是一個能在沒有jquery的情況下使用的ajax方法.所以我也花一天時間寫了一個,參數與調用方法類似於jquery的ajax.就叫xhr吧,因為xhr=XMLHttpReque

自己實現ajax封裝樣本分享_javascript技巧

複製代碼 代碼如下: //javascript Object: ajax Object//Created By RexLeefunction Ajax(url,data){    this.url=url;    this.data=data;    this.browser=(function(){        &

Ajax提交與傳統表單提交的區別說明_javascript技巧

Ajax提交是通過js來提交請求,請求與響應均由js引擎來處理,頁面不會重新整理,使用者感覺不到實際上瀏覽器發出了請求。比如說我們希望網頁總是顯示最新的新聞,而又不想老是去點重新整理按鈕,我們就可以用Ajax機制來實現。網上的客服軟體也是ajax請求的一個比較好的案例。傳統的請求頁面將實現重新整理,因此局限性很大。1.為什麼用AJAX?使用AJAX,使用者對Web的體驗會更“敏捷”:資料提交頁面不會閃屏;頁面局部更新速度快;網路頻寬佔用低。2.AJAX開發相較傳統模式的簡單之處:傳統模式下,表單

js鎖屏解屏通過對$.ajax進行封裝實現_javascript技巧

jquery外掛程式源碼:/*** 對jquery中$.ajax進行封裝,以便加入鎖屏功能* isAsync 是否為非同步請求,預設為true* isLock 是否鎖屏,預設是true* isCache 是否從瀏覽器緩衝中載入資訊,預設是fasle***/;(function($) {$.fn.doPost = function(settings) {settings = jQuery.extend({isAsync:true,type : "post",url : null,dataType

jquery ajax應用中iframe自適應高度問題解決方案_javascript技巧

iframe自適應高度本身是很簡單的方法,就是在頁面載入完成後,重新計算一下高度即可。代碼如下:複製代碼 代碼如下://公用方法:設定iframe的高度以保證全部顯示資料//function SetPageHeight() {//    var iframe = getUrlParam('ifname');//    var myiframe = window.parent.document.getElementById(iframe)

JavaScript調用ajax擷取文字檔內容實現代碼_javascript技巧

這幾年JQuery寫多了,傳統的的javascript已經很久不寫了,不少東西都忘掉了,還有多少人記得javascript中實現ajax操作需要藉助XMLHttpRequest對象,其實jquery的ajax本質也是這個,好了,今天就花點時間示範一下如何用傳統javascript擷取常值內容並展示在頁面上,廢話不多少,直接上代碼,注釋寫的很詳細,大家應該能看懂: 複製代碼 代碼如下: <script type="text/javascript">

基於iframe實作類別似於ajax的頁面無重新整理_javascript技巧

本方法是基於iframe實現的,需求是form表單提交帶有檔案上傳的input標籤,因此不能使用ajax來提交 首先: 複製代碼 代碼如下: <form id="form0" action="${pageContext.request.contextPath}/news/baikeAdd.form" enctype="multipart/form-data" method="POST" target="hidden_frame"> ... ... </form> <

ajax請求亂碼的解決方案(中文亂碼)_javascript技巧

今天遇到一個問題,有關ajax請求中傳輸中文,遇到亂碼的問題。如下代碼:複製代碼 代碼如下:function UpdateFolderInfoByCustId(folderId, folderName, custId) {    $.ajax({        type: "Post",        contentType:

JavaScript AJAX之惰性載入函數_javascript技巧

在JS中有些記憶體只需執行一遍即可,如瀏覽器類型檢測是最常用的一個功能,因為我們使用Ajax的時候需要檢測瀏覽器的內建的XHR。我們可以在第一次檢測的時候記錄下類型,往後在使用Ajax的時候就不需要再去檢測瀏覽器類型了。在JS中就算只有一個if也總比沒有if的語句效率要高。普通Ajax方法複製代碼 代碼如下:/** * JS惰性函數 */ function ajax(){    if(typeof XMLHttpRequest != "

總頁數: 351 1 .... 272 273 274 275 276 .... 351 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.